Output 161877a341a489f05ceb94495aa50fac3a38d9914823d99341633091cc57ed00:28

value
775409
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b2134ce718128671a58cbf7205f3a8302dc19d6 OP_EQUALVERIFY OP_CHECKSIG
address
16PeeXmPGfTLZyDEwvPjeLr2ip9HRc7fK6
transaction
161877a341a489f05ceb94495aa50fac3a38d9914823d99341633091cc57ed00
spent
true